Karuizawa

Getting Here and Around

Coming from Tokyo, Karuizawa is a nice stop en route to the hot-spring towns of Kusatsu and Yudanaka or Matsumoto and Kamikochi. The town itself is easy to explore by foot, taxi, or bicycle. Naka-Karuizawa Station, one stop (five minutes) away on the Shinano Tetsudo line, is a gateway to Shiraito and Ryugaeshi waterfalls, the Yacho wild bird sanctuary, and hiking trails. Karuizawa is very crowded from mid-July to the end of August. If you are visiting during this time, book your accommodation well in advance.

Karuizawa Tourist Information Service is inside the JR station.
